Problem

Users, especially elderly or disabled individuals, face difficulties in maintaining medicament delivery devices in a vertical orientation for proper priming and storage, as some medicaments require mixing of unstable components that degrade quickly, necessitating immediate use and manual handling.

Innovation Solution

A system of interconnected stands that can be manually broken loose to support medicament delivery devices in a vertical orientation, allowing for easy handling and storage, with features like self-righting stands and RFID readers for information management.

AI summary

An arrangement for supporting a plurality of medicament delivery devices is presented that has a plurality of interconnected stands, with each stand being configured to support a medicament delivery device and where the arrangement is configured such that each stand can be manually broken loose from an adjacent stand of the arrangement. A system is also presented where the arrangement contains a plurality of medicament delivery devices positioned in the arrangement.
